Summary This volume challenges the proposition that regional organizations across the world exhibit increasing similarities with the European Union as a result of norm diffusion. It examines how and to what extent Indonesian foreign policy stakeholders-the government, civil society, legislators, the academe, the press and business representatives-sought to influence reforms of Southeast Asian regionalism by adopting ideas and norms of regional integration championed by the EU.
